>> +/**
>> + * hib_io_handle_alloc - allocate io handle with priv_size for private data
>> + *
>> + * @priv_size: the sie to allocate behind hibernate_io_handle for private use
>> + */
>> +static inline struct hibernate_io_handle *hib_io_handle_alloc(size_t priv_size)
>> +{
>> + struct hibernate_io_handle *ret;
>> + ret = kzalloc(sizeof(*ret) + priv_size, GFP_KERNEL);
>> + if (ret)
>> + ret->priv = ret + 1;
>
> Uhuh, why this? Aha, grabbing the pointer to priv_size-sized area at
> the end of regular struct?
Yes, exactly, any more transparent way to do it?
